The Wildling Art Museum offered a day-long program on November 14 under the auspices of Santa Barbara City College Continuing Education Program. Entitled Art at the Wildling Art Museum: Dick Smith and the Santa Barbara Back Country, it provided background information on the current exhibition, Dick Smith and His Back Country Wilderness, and enlightened students about the San Rafael and Dick Smith Wilderness Areas, their topography, flora and fauna, and historic sites.
The program began at 10 a.m. at the Museum, 2329 Jonata Street in Los Olivos, where students met with Jessica Reichman, curator of the exhibition. After lunch the class reconvened in the afternoon to see a slide presentation by Ray Ford, author of A Hikers Guide to the Dick Smith Wilderness, and other hiking maps.
